The PM has just concluded his daily briefing.  Here is what he announced:
- $306 million + support for Indigenous businesses; interest free and non-repayable contributions
- Canada/US border will be closed for a further 30 days
 
The interesting comments actually came today during the question and answer component with the media.  A Global TV reporter made me very happy - she said to the PM that small businesses have been forced to close but are still expected to make all of their bill payments so what is happening with the Emergency Rent Support program that the PM referenced earlier in the week.  The PM stated that he had discussed this issue with the Premiers during his Thursday night call and they're still looking at it. He said again that it has to be a collaborative negotiation as the Provinces oversee the issue of landlords and tenants and rent.  Another reporter stated that most of the proposals to assist small businesses immediately ie. rent relief are coming from members of the opposition and should the PM not be working more closely with them.  The PM said that they are working closely with the opposition parties.
